Study on three-dimensional changes of soft tissue in various facial areas after bimaxillary surgery in patients with skeletal Class III malocclusion

摘要: 目的 探究骨性Ⅲ类错畸形患者双颌手术后面部各区域软组织的变化特点。 方法 2017—2019年于我院就诊的18例骨性Ⅲ类错畸形患者,男女各9例。使用3dMD摄影测量系统分别于双颌手术前一周内任一天和术后6个月拍摄患者面部图像,并通过Geomagic Qualify软件对手术前后的面部图像进行三维重建和匹配,分割各个面部区域,得出面部各区域软组织的变化量。 结果 术后颞区(R1)软组织改变量为-0.17 mm,颧弓区(R4)为-0.42 mm,下口角旁区(R11)为-0.81 mm,下唇及颏区(M3)为-3.08 mm,呈负向改变(P<0.05);眶下区(R2)软组织改变量为0.29 mm,鼻翼旁区(R5)为1.58 mm,上口角旁区(R8)1.08 mm,鼻区(M1)为0.59 mm,上唇区(M2)为2.05 mm,呈正向改变(P<0.05);左右两侧相同面部区域的软组织变化无统计学差异(P>0.05);同区域男性与女性的软组织变化差异无统计学意义(P>0.05)。 结论 骨性Ⅲ类错畸形患者双颌手术后颞区、颧弓区、下口角旁区、下唇及颏区的软组织变得凹陷,而眶下区、鼻翼旁区、上口角旁区、鼻区、上唇区的软组织变得凸出。术后左右侧相同面部区域的软组织改变无差异,性别对术后面部各区域软组织的改变没有影响。

Abstract: Objective  To explore the characteristics of soft tissue changes in different facial areas after maxillofacial surgery in patients with skeletal Class III malocclusion. Methods  Eighteen cases of skeletal Class III malocclusion in our hospital from 2017 to 2019,9 cases of male and female. Using 3dMD photogrammetry system, the facial images of the patients were taken on any day of the week before and 6 months after the surgery. The facial images before and after the operation were reconstructed and matched by Geomagic Qualify. Then the changes of soft tissue in each area of the face were obtained. Results  The changes of soft tissue after operation were -0.17 mm in temporal region (R1), -0.42 mm in zygomatic arch area (R4), -0.81 mm in under the mouth next district (R11)and -3.08 mm in lower lip and chin area (M3). Negative changes happened in the above regions (P<0.05); The soft tissue changes were 0.29 mm in infraorbital region (R2), 1.58 mm in paranasal area, 1.08 mm in on the mouth next district (R8), 0.59 mm in nasal region (M1),and 2.05 mm in superior labial region (M2) . Positive changes happened in the above regions (P<0.05). Soft tissue changes in both sides of the same facial area were not significantly different (P>0.05); and the differences between men and women in soft tissue changes of the same region had no statistical significance (P>0.05). Conclusions  The soft tissue of patients with skeletal Class III malocclusion in temporal region, zygomatic arch area, under the mouth next district, lower lip and chin area became depressed after bimaxillary surgery, while the soft tissue in infraorbital region, paranasal area, on the mouth next district, nasal area and superior labial region became protruding. There was no difference in soft tissue changes in the same facial area on the left and right sides, and gender had no effect on the changes of soft tissue in each area of the face after surgery.
